Resi Gotama, the son of Dewatama was a respected and sakti (having strong supernatural power) hermit from an abode (Padepokan) in the mountain of Sukendra. He dedicated his ascetic life to preserve the world for the welfare of mankind (Mamayu Hayuning Buwono). He had done a lot of things as assigned by heaven. His works were highly appreciated by Betara Guru and other responsible gods.

In the lonesome pictoresque Padepokan, he lived with his beautiful wife, a goddess Dewi Windradi. They had three healthy and good-looking children. The eldest was Dewi Anjani, a beautiful sexy lady. She had a smooth light color of skin. The second and the third were strong and handsome sons: Guwarsi (Subali) and Guwarsa (Sugriwa).

The tranquile life of the hermit in Mt. Sukendra was disturbed by Betara/god Surya, who had a reputation to play around with beautiful women. He made a love affairs with the attractive Windradi. He gave a wonderful toy, called Cupumanik Astagina. Through it, all wonders of the world and what was happening in the world, could be seen clearly.

Windradi gave the toy to her daughter, Anjani. But her brothers wanted also to have it. They were quarreling noisely for the toy. Resi Gotama saw the toy and he knew what had been happened. He could not control his anger, he cursed his wife to be a stone statue. His two sons became monkeys and also Anjani’s face, hands and feet. Her sexy body remained intact. (see Ramayana).

Resi Gotama did not want to live anymore in this dirty world. With Guru’s consent, he was transformed to be a god and permitted to live in the abode of gods. Windradi, as a punishment had to remain stone statue for several years.

Dewi Anjani’s sexy body had tempted Betara Guru himself and a son in the form of a white monkey (Ketek Putih), Anoman was born.

In Javanese mystics, Ketek Putih was a name of a powerful Aji-Aji/mantra. It was said that Ketek Putih could be the fastest messenger in the world, doing any task, instructed by the owner. Anjani, after the birth of Anoman, as the wife of Guru, lived in the abode of gods. Resi Subali, was killed by Rama’s arrow, Guwa Wijaya.

Prabu Sugriwa, became the king of Gua Kiskenda, the kingdom of the monkeys. He and the whole army of monkeys served faithfully to Rama to free Sinta from Alengka. He married to Dewi Tara and had a son Anggada, who became the chief-warrior of the kingdom.

Another famous figure was Anila, a warrior and Prime Minister of Gua Kiskenda. He killed Patih Prahasta of Alengka, by hitting Prahasta’s head with the stone statue of Windradi. The statue was broken into pieces, it ended the punishment of Windradi. She returned to live with other gods.

Anila was the son of Betara Narada. Narada was mocking Guru, who due to his uncontrolable desire to Anjani, had a white monkey son. Guru was angry, with his spiritual strenght, he created a blue monkey on the back of Narada. Narada recognized Anila as his son.
